Tackling the Nigerian Market: Experiential Marketing Best Practices
Plunge headfirst into the vibrant mosaic that is the Nigerian market and you'll uncover a thriving consumer base eager to connect with brands on a personal level. Experiential marketing, with its ability to forge lasting memories and nurture authentic connections, is the tool to unlock this potential.
However, navigating this dynamic market requires a strategic approach. Consider these best practices:
- Focus on local culture and customs. Your campaigns should connect to the heart of Nigerian values
- Collaborate with influential Nigerians who grasp the market's nuances.
- Offer interactive and engaging experiences that create a lasting feeling
- Harness technology to enhance the reach and impact of your campaigns.
By embracing these best practices, you can efficiently navigate the Nigerian market and achieve lasting success through experiential marketing.
